What is a Markiseteppe?

A markiseteppe is essentially an awning fabric used to cover and protect outdoor areas. It is usually attached to a frame, which allows it to extend or retract based on the need for shade. These coverings are found in homes, restaurants, and commercial areas where outdoor seating is common.

In addition to their practical function, they are also seen as a decorative feature. Since they come in various patterns, textures, and colors, they allow people to personalize their outdoor space while enjoying comfort and shade.

History of Markiseteppe

The use of fabric to create shade dates back to ancient civilizations. Egyptians used woven mats to shield themselves from the scorching desert sun, while the Romans installed large canvas coverings in amphitheaters to protect spectators. Over time, these coverings evolved into modern awnings and markiseteppe.

In Norway and other parts of Europe, markiseteppe became common during the 19th and 20th centuries, when outdoor living spaces started gaining popularity. Today, their designs are more advanced, offering durability, weather resistance, and stylish appeal.

Types of Markiseteppe

There are several types of markiseteppe, each catering to different needs.

Retractable Markiseteppe

These coverings can extend or retract depending on the weather. They are highly versatile and perfect for patios and balconies.

Fixed Markiseteppe

A fixed markiseteppe remains in place permanently. While it cannot be adjusted, it offers continuous protection and durability.

Vertical Markiseteppe

Also known as drop awnings, these extend downward and provide shade from the front, making them ideal for windows and balconies.

Motorized Markiseteppe

Equipped with a motor, these coverings can be operated with the push of a button, offering maximum convenience and luxury.

Materials Used in Markiseteppe

The durability of a markiseteppe depends on its fabric. Some of the most common materials include:

  • Acrylic Fabric: Highly resistant to fading, water, and UV rays.

  • Polyester: Affordable and durable, though less resistant to fading.

  • Canvas: Traditional and sturdy, but requires more maintenance.

  • Vinyl-Coated Fabrics: Waterproof and easy to clean, ideal for areas with heavy rain.

Each material has its strengths, but modern options often combine style with weather resistance, ensuring long-lasting performance.

Maintenance Tips for Markiseteppe

To keep a markiseteppe in great condition, regular care is necessary.

  • Clean fabric regularly with mild soap and water.

  • Avoid using harsh chemicals that can damage fibers.

  • Retract during heavy rain, storms, or strong winds.

  • Check the frame for rust or damage.

  • Store removable coverings during winter if not designed for snow.

Proper maintenance ensures longevity and prevents costly replacements.

Markiseteppe vs. Other Shade Options

While umbrellas, pergolas, and shade sails also provide cover, a markiseteppe offers several advantages. Unlike umbrellas, it covers larger areas. Compared to pergolas, it is more flexible since it can retract. Unlike shade sails, it provides more control over sunlight exposure.

This versatility makes markiseteppe a preferred choice for many homeowners.
